The chief minister also declared three districts - West Godavari, Krishna and SPS Nellore - as open defecation-free (ODF) and said the target was to make the entire state ODF by March 2018.
"We created history in the country by inaugurating one lakh houses in a day. One lakh houses each will be inaugurated on December 25 (2017), January 14 and June 8 next year," Naidu said on the occasion.
The state government targeted to build 17.40 lakh houses for weaker sections, including 12 lakh in rural areas, at a total cost of Rs 50,000 crore, he said.
Another 21.61 lakh toilets were still required to be built out of the total target of 48.20 lakh, he said.
